Women who are preparing for pregnancy or are about to become pregnant should take folic acid appropriately, the amount of folic acid is 0.4 mg per day. Taking it for 3 months before and after pregnancy, that is, taking it for 6 consecutive months, can effectively prevent newborn's central nervous system defects. In terms of diet, eat more foods rich in folic acid, such as bamboo shoots, broccoli, tomatoes, carrots, greens, asparagus, cauliflower, rapeseed, cabbage, snow peas, peas, fungi and so on. Women can prevent most neural tube defects in the fetus by taking 0.4 mg of folic acid supplements (product name: "Silian") daily during the three months of preparation for pregnancy to the first three months of pregnancy. Folic acid should be supplemented three months before pregnancy and continued until the third month of pregnancy. It needs to be taken daily. Sometimes skipping one day will not have much impact.
